Applications open soon for Round 4 of USDA ReConnect Program funding

More funding is being made available from President Biden’s Bipartisan Infrastructure Law to increase access to affordable high-speed internet.

Rural Development Undersecretary Xochitl Torres Small says high-speed internet is needed across Rural America, “Going from the farm to the school to households to international markets, connectivity drives that positive change that helps strengthen our rural communities.”

To be eligible for ReConnect funding Torres Small says proposed areas must be rural and/or lack sufficient access to broadband service. 

She says providers have to provide sufficient access to rural broadband, “They have to provide speeds of at least one hundred up, one hundred down, and that increase in download speed is crucial for things like precision ag, so farmers can be the best stewards that they want to be.”

She says this funding will help everyone in America, regardless of where they live, because rural Americans provide the everyday essentials the country depends on.

Applications for round four funding for the USDA ReConnect Program will open September 6.  Individuals are not able to apply however, corporations, limited liability companies and limited liability partnerships, cooperatives, state or local governments, a territory or possession of the United States, and or an Indiana tribe can.
